Population in July 2008: 24,116. Population change since 2000: +38.2%
Males: 12,058  (50.0%)
Females: 12,058  (50.0%)

Median resident age:  32.2 years
Minnesota median age:  35.4 years

Zip codes: 55318.


Estimated median household income in 2007: $72,691 (it was $60,325 in 2000)
Chaska:  $72,691
Minnesota:  $55,802

Estimated per capita income in 2007: $32,104
Chaska:  $32,104
Minnesota:  $29,027

Estimated median house or condo value in 2007: $258,167 (it was $149,000 in 2000)
Chaska:  $258,167
Minnesota:  $213,600

Chaska-area historical tornado activity is above Minnesota state average. It is 85% greater than the overall U.S. average.

On 5/6/1965, a category 4 (max. wind speeds 207-260 mph) tornado 4.3 miles away from the Chaska city center caused between $5,000,000 and $50,000,000 in damages.

On 5/6/1965, a category 4 tornado 7.7 miles away from the city center killed 3 people and injured 175 people and caused between $5,000,000 and $50,000,000 in damages.


Chaska-area historical earthquake activity is significantly below Minnesota state average. It is 100% smaller than the overall U.S. average.

On 2/9/1994 at 08:45:35, a magnitude 3.1 (3.1 LG, Depth: 3.1 mi, Class: Light, Intensity: II - III) earthquake occurred 69.9 miles away from Chaska center
